CASPER, WYOMING (March 29, 2021) – The Casper-Natrona County Health Department (CNCHD) is opening Phase 2 of its vaccination efforts, so now anyone over the age of 16 in Natrona County is now eligible to receive a COVID-19 vaccination.
Since administering Casper’s first vaccine Dec. 16, the CNCHD has gradually expanded eligibility requirements to include more occupations, age group and health conditions, according to Wyoming Department of Health guidelines. Today marks the first time that anyone who wants a vaccine can sign up for an appointment.
“This is a moment we’ve been waiting for since March of 2020,” CNCHD Public Information Officer Hailey Bloom said. “This is how we’re going to get our town back. Our community’s vaccination efforts are well ahead of schedule, and it’s all thanks to our incredible team, healthcare partners and the people of Natrona County,” she said.
While anyone in Natrona County is eligible, there are some important health guidelines. To receive a vaccination, you cannot be ill, and you cannot have received any other vaccinations within two weeks of your vaccination. You must be at least 16 years of age to receive a Pfizer vaccine, and at least 18 to receive either Moderna or Johnson and Johnson.
